The Role

Plaster Group LLC is a business and technology consulting company. We are looking to hire a Sr. Consultant to join our team and lead our clients' projects. This person will lead highly complex projects and phases of complex projects for a business unit, department, or functional area. The Sr. Project Management consultant may need to provide some limited functional support for the department. The ideal candidate is a polished IT professional who has the soft skills to navigate competing stakeholder interests, motivate a highly capable delivery team, and implement a quality solution in a timely, predictable manner.

Responsibilities:

  • Coordinate or participate in all phases of the project lifecycle, including planning, design, development, testing, implementation, documentation, training, and closure
  • Ensure that the project achieves the expected results within time and on budget
  • Direct the work of others
  • Ensure effective ongoing communication throughout the project
  • Meet with key managers to coordinate meetings, assignments and deadlines
  • Communicate changes to appropriate parties; Identify issues and resolve or escalate them as appropriate.
  • Gather, organize, analyze and, report information in support of moderately complex projects to improve profitability, reduce costs, streamline operations, or enhance customer service
  • Represent business unit, department, or functional area on cross-functional project teams; Track progress towards achievement of project goals
  • Facilitate complex team meetings involving business and technical resources; Demonstrate credibility as an IT partner to ensure business and technology decisions are reached to support business goals and objectives.
  • Maintain project documentation and prepare activity reports on the project's status, timeline, and budgets
